纳秒强激光场中甲醇光电离产生高价离子的研究   总被引:1,自引:1,他引:0       下载免费PDF全文
利用25ns脉冲Nd YAG 532nm的激光,在1011 W·cm-2的光场强度下,利用飞 行时间质谱对He, N2, Ar载气条件下甲醇的激光电离过程进行了研究.发现当利用氩作为 载气时,除观察到一般多光子电离所产生的离子和碎片离子外,还观察到很强的Cq+(q=2-4)和Oq+(q=2—4)高价离子.这些离子都有很高的平动能,通 过改变载 气种类和压力以及使用不同延迟条件的脉冲电场的实验,可以认为这些高价离子来源于含甲 醇团簇的库仑爆炸过程.这些实验结果为发展库仑爆炸理论研究提供新思路. 关键词: 甲醇 纳秒激光 高价离子 库仑爆炸  相似文献

利用脉宽为25 ns的脉冲:Nd:YAG 1064 nm的激光,在1010~1011 W·cm-2的强度下,用飞行时间质谱对乙腈分子束激光电离过程进行了研究.实验中利用氦气作为载气,乙腈分子束采用扩散和脉冲两种方式进样,当扩散束进样时,乙腈分子的谱峰可用多光子电离来解释,而当脉冲分子束进样时,实验中产生了外层价电子高剥离的Nq (q=2~5)和Cq (q=1~4)信号谱.实验中同时发现,激光波长增大时,高价离子的谱强度也趋向于增大.激光延迟及谱峰的相关性分析表明,这些高价离子可能来源于乙腈团簇的库仑爆炸过程.提出一个多光子电离引发,逆韧致吸收加热一电子碰撞电离模型来解释高价离子的产生,对高价离子伴随的波长效应也给出了较为合理的解释.  相似文献

用一束波长为360.55nm的激光,通过N2O分子的(3+1)共振多光子电离(REMPI)过程制备纯净且布居完全处于X2Ⅱ(000)态的母体离子N2O+,然后用另一束波长在275-328nm范围内的可调谐激光将制备的N2O+离子激发至预解离电子态A2∑+.实验发现,由于解离碎片NO+所具有的一定的反冲速度,其TOF质谱峰明显比N2O+母体宽.通过分析NO+碎片TOF质谱峰形状,得到了解离产物的总平均平动能;通过考察随光解能量的变化,发现光解能量在32000cm-1附近约250cm-1的变化范围内,值由约8000cm-1突然减小至约1600cm-1.通过分析,在光解能量小于32000cm-1的区域,解离通道为NO+(X1∑+)+N(4S);而在光解能量大于32000cm-1的区域,另一个具有较高解离限的解离通道,NO+(X1∑+)+N(2D),开启并完全取代N(4S)通道成为解离的惟一通道.根据实验结果,对在所研究的光解能量范围内的N2O+离子A2∑+电子态预解离机理进行了探讨.  相似文献

用一束波长为360.55 nm的激光,通过N2O分子的(3+1)共振增强多光子电离过程制备纯净的母体离子N2O+X2Ⅱ3/2,1/2(000).用另一束可调谐激光将N2O+离子激发至预解离态A2Σ+,利用飞行时间质谱检测解离碎片NO+离子强度随光解光波长的变化,在278-328 nm波长范围内获得了光解碎片的激发(PHOFEX)谱.观测到了N2O+离子A2Σ+←X2Ⅱ电子跃迁较丰富的振动谱带.通过对PHOFEX光谱的标识,获得了A2∑+态较准确和全面的分子光谱常数.  相似文献

纳秒激光电离分子团簇产生高价离子实验研究   总被引:1,自引:1,他引:0       下载免费PDF全文
 利用飞行时间质谱仪,研究了功率密度为109~1011 W/cm2,波长为532 nm 的纳秒激光对苯、呋喃、甲醇及碘甲烷分子团簇的激光电离过程。实验观察到了高平动能的高价离子Cq+(q≤3),Oq+(q≤3)和Iq+(q≤4),该过程经历了以“初始的多光子电离引发-逆轫致吸收加热-电子碰撞电离模式”为主的激光团簇作用过程,后期经历了团簇的库仑爆炸过程。实验发现:即使激光能量变化一个量级以上时,主要高价离子的种类及占全部离子产物的比率也没有明显的变化,但是高价离子的初始平动能随激光强度的增大而增加;分子中含有较多个外壳层电子的氧、碘原子更容易电离产生高价离子,而碳离子的价态和强度相对较低。  相似文献

利用Bathe模型,理论模拟了氩团簇在飞秒强激光中(100 fs, 1016 W/cm2)的电离和爆炸过程.研究结果显示,在团簇尺寸较小时,离子平均能量与团簇初始半径平方成正比,爆炸机制为典型的库仑爆炸.随着团簇尺寸的增加,能量增加的速度趋缓并在一定团簇尺寸后趋于饱和.模拟结果与实验数据有较好的吻合.  相似文献

用速度成像技术研究了氮分子在410和820 nm线偏振飞秒激光场中(1014 W/cm2)碎片化过程.N2在410 nm激光场中碎片化行为与820 nm激光场中不同,碎片离子的能量分布和角分布不随410 nm激光场强明显变化.氮分子在410 nm激光场中的碎片化过程主要是由垂直激发导致的非库仑态解离引起的.  相似文献

Cyclic competition game models, particularly the “rock–paper–scissors” model, play important roles in exploring the problem of multi-species coexistence in spatially ecological systems. We propose an extended “rock–paper–scissors” game to model cyclic interactions among five species, and find that two of the five can coexistent when biodiversity disappears, which is different from the “rock–paper–scissors” game. As the number of fingers is five, we named the new model the “fingers” game, where the thumb, forefinger, middle finger, ring finger, and little finger cyclically dominate their subsequent species and are dominated by their former species. We investigate the “fingers” model in two ways: direct simulations and nonlinear partial differential equations. An important finding is that the number of species in a cyclic competition game has an influence on the emergence of biodiversity. To be specific, the “rock–paper–scissors” model is in favor of maintaining biodiversity in comparison with the “fingers” model when the variables (population size, reproduction rate, selection rate, and migration rate) are the same. It is also shown that the mobility and reproduction rate can promote or jeopardize biodiversity.  相似文献

Downstep in pitch contour of Chinese Putonghua is examined using subtly designed sentences by controlling tone combinations. The results show both automatic and nonautomatic downstep phenomena exist in Chinese. In non-automatic downstep, low tones compress downwards the pitch range of the following syllables. and the main influence of downstep is on topline. Low tone not only lower the topline behind it, but also raise the high tones before it, the effects are compatible with each other. In automatic downstep, the topline of pitch contour in intonational phrase is presented as a linear downtrend, but it differs among speakers due to the effect of personal stress practice. In comparison with downstep phenomenon in other tone or non-tone languages, the downstep ratio in Chinese is not constant, and the domain of downstep is not limited within the adjacent tones.  相似文献

The differences of the pitch and duration of Chinese syllables between Putonghua (PTH) and Taiwan Mandarin (TM) were studied. The speech materials to be used are not only isolated syllables, but also sentences. The results reveal that: For the isolated syllables, T1 and T2 in TM are influenced by Minnan dialect, therefore their pitch are lower than those in PTH. T3 is fall-rise in PTH, while it is fall in TM. Moreover, the syllable duration sequence for different tone is T3〉T2〉T1〉T4 in PTH, while it is T1〉T2〉T3〉T4 in TM. For the syllables in sentences, T2 is mid-rise in PTH, while it is mid-level in TM. And the T3 is longer than T4 but shorter than T1 or T2 in PTH, while it is the shortest in TM. Furthermore the effects of prosodic phrase boundary on duration for different tones are almost the same in PTH, but the lengthening part of T1 or T2 is longer than that of T3 or T4 in TM.  相似文献

[5][Materials Science and Engineering, 1989; A122: 57 63], an improved model of heat source is set up, the different modes of Lamb wave in an isotropic sample generated by a chopped electron beam at frequency f are obtained with integral transform and normal function expansion method, and the output signal of PZT coupled at the back surface of the sample is found out. The generation mechanism of SEAM (Scanning Electron Acoustic Microscopy) signal is discussed. It shows that the SEAM is a near field imaging technique with high spatial resolution and its best lateral spatial resolution is about 2√2α (α is the radius of the focused electron beam). Some of experimental results of SEAM images are presented in the paper and it shows that the spatial resolution of SEAM is better than 0.5 μm and smaller than the thermal diffusion length of the sample. Therefore the character of near field imaging in SEAM is also proved experimentally.  相似文献

Transmission spectra of coupled cavity structures (CCSs) in two-dimensional (2D) photonic crystals (PCs) are investigated using a coupled mode theory, and an optical filter based on CCS is proposed. The performance of the filter is investigated using finite-difference time-domain (FDTD) method, and the results show that within a very short coupling distance of about 3λ, where λ is the wavelength of signal in vacuum, the incident signals with different frequencies are separated into different channels with a contrast ratio of 20 dB. The advantages of this kind of filter are small size and easily tunable operation frequencies.  相似文献

Real-time, continuous-wave terahertz imaging by a pyroelectric camera   总被引:1,自引:0,他引:1  
Real-time, continuous-wave terahertz (THz) imaging is demonstrated. A 1.89-THz optically-pumped farinfrared laser is used as the illumination source, and a 124 × 124 element room-temperature pyroelectric camera is adopted as the detector. With this setup, THz images through various wrapping materials are shown. The results show that this imaging system has the potential applications in real-time mail and security inspection.  相似文献
